Output 3e09265e902b4b2c2b00a06f1da19ddc839e01b6d3d431af8e8fa60b384cdb53:1

value
670126
script pubkey
OP_0 OP_PUSHBYTES_20 62e88ee2e24f41ae843ce3b06a1d2b41726692e5
address
bc1qvt5gachzfaq6appuuwcx58ftg9exdyh9d4esv5
transaction
3e09265e902b4b2c2b00a06f1da19ddc839e01b6d3d431af8e8fa60b384cdb53
confirmations
218891
spent
true